My great great grandmother, Sarah Ann Brown was born around 1830 and died in early 1900. She is the daughter of Joseph Brown. Sarah married John Hedden. their daughter is Nancy Hedden Allen, my great grandmother. My grandmother is Oma Lee Allen Berrong.

This is the story my grandmother told:
"When I was a little girl my grandmother (Sarah Brown) died in our family's cabin. The Indians (Cherokees) came on horseback and got my grandmother's body and put it on a travois and took her to the "Mountain of Many Faces" (Snowbird?)."

I have so many questions. Why did the Cherokees come and get her? Who was Sarah Brown and who was Joseph Brown?
Now, here is the reason I am writing this in the Dalton Family section. I have heard the story told by others that "on the the way (to wherever they were taking the body) they stopped at THE DALTON FARM and camped for the night.

Does anything sound familiar to anyone.? I would love to hear form any Dalton researcher working on or with knowledge of Polk County or Cherokee County history.

Thanks for ANYTHING.
